Definitions For Mosasaur

Noun

MOSASAUR (plural MOSASAURs) A large extinct marine reptile in the family mosasauridae, dominant marine predator of the cretaceous. Mosasaurs are considred to be in squmata, the same group that includes lizards and snakes.from c. 1840
